Abstract

In this paper, we propose security mechanism for Ad-hoc OLSR protocol We consider the security vulnerabilities for OLSR and apply one-time digital signature for lightweight authentication of the routing messages We also propose compromised node management mechanism in which normal nodes collaborate to report malfunctioning nodes and to isolate them from network We finally analyze the security and overhead of our mechanism.
